## Further reading

All third-party fonts in Quillbrand are vendored under `assets/fonts/` with license files alongside. Do not fetch fonts at build time; the Marrowlane CDN is not an approved source. Review the license matrix before approving additions or subset changes. The full vendoring policy and approval workflow live on the internal page here.

wiki page, fahaf-yagag: https://confluence.qorvellabs.internal/pages/display/pages/display

**Vendor note: Inkmill markdown pipeline**

Rendering for Parchway docs is outsourced to Inkmill under an annual contract, renewing each March. They handle sanitization and PDF export; we own the upload queue. SLA: 4-hour response on rendering failures. Escalate only after two failed retries. Their support desk is reachable at the address below.

billing contact of hahaf-baguf = zorael.tammir.jorius@sivrelhq.internal

# Break-Glass: Catalog Cache Invalidation

Scope: the Pinrow product catalog at Veldstone Retail. If stale prices persist after a purge and the Hollowmere invalidation queue is wedged, use break-glass to flush the edge tier directly. Contractors: get verbal sign-off from the catalog lead first. Steps: open the Hollowmere admin shell, select emergency-flush, confirm the tenant, and run it once — repeated flushes thrash the origin. Access is logged and expires after 20 minutes. Unseal the admin shell with the passphrase below.

recovery phrase for kahop-tajog: istix-casvan

TURN-208: Gatevale turnstile counters at the Merrow Field pilot double-count when a rotation reverses mid-cycle. Attendance totals drift roughly 2% high per event. The debounce window fix is implemented, reviewed by Ilsa, and soak-tested across two simulated match days without drift. Ready for your cut; the candidate build is identified below.

trace token, tagag-tafog: htk6_5ed18c